Mogadishu — A joint operation by the National Intelligence and Security Agency (NISA), the Somali National Army (SNA), and international partners targeted al-Shabaab in Hiiraan.
Over 40 militants were killed in the Ceelhareeri area. The operation was precise and focused on a hidden location. It also destroyed vehicles used by the group.
Among those killed was Abuu Anas, head of logistics for combat units. Mohamed Ahmed (Xerow), a senior field commander, was also confirmed dead. Nuur Cabdi Rooble (Nuunuule) and Commander Jeylaani sustained critical injuries during the operation.
These leaders were linked to recent suicide attacks in Hiiraan and Middle Shabelle. This successful operation disrupts their capabilities and undermines their plans against Somalis.
